In this premiere episode of the new podcast, "Unknown to Known," an (ON CAM) Ready presentation series hosted by Jamie Maglietta, listeners had the opportunity to hear from Allison Bettes, a meteorologist making waves as a romance novelist. The episode explored the challenges and triumphs of balancing public personas with personal passions.
Jamie, leveraging her extensive experience in television news, engaged Allison in a discussion about the duality many face when transitioning between professional and personal identities. As Allison shared, "Whether you work in television or not, you have your work version of yourself, and then you have your at-home version of yourself." The pandemic provided Allison with the space to merge her love for science with creative writing, allowing her to flourish in both roles.
To help others build confidence and authenticity on camera, Allison recommended a simple yet effective strategy: "Pretend the people you're talking to are your family and friends." Jamie and Allison highlighted the importance of practice and preparation, emphasizing the role of recording oneself to refine presentation skills.
Ultimately, Allison’s venture into authorship illustrates the power of pursuing new challenges and passions. Her encouraging words, "If there's part of you that wants to do this... just do it," resonate with anyone standing on the brink of a new journey. Through this inspiring conversation, Jamie Maglietta and Allison Bettes remind us that embracing our ambitions can lead to profound and fulfilling changes.
